Which piece of Shanghai food is concentrated in?

In fact, the purpose of going to Shanghai to find food is not the food itself, but another Shanghai-style food taste that you can't eat anywhere else.

There are many food streets in Shanghai, among which Yunnan Road, Zhapu Road and huanghe road are famous. In recent years, many new fashion food streets have sprung up, such as Western Fashion Hongji Plaza and Xintiandi Restaurant Plaza. Yunnan road is a veteran food street, and now it mainly focuses on snacks; Zhapu Road and huanghe road have gradually emerged in the past 11 years, but Zhapu Road has almost withered, and food is no longer the protagonist. During the period when clothing and beauty shops are full, it is becoming less and less like it. Huanghe road is still full of restaurants, and a narrow alley is crowded with cars of different colors and grades. The bustling scene is extraordinary; Western fashion Hongji Square and Oriental Xintiandi are full of white-collar workers and petty bourgeoisie.

Yunnan Road: Yunnan Road is strategically located at the junction of Yan 'an Road and Tibet Road, close to the central area of People's Square. At night, there will be many nightingale stalls in the alley and downstairs, and spending a few dollars to eat a nightingale is the consumption mode of many citizens. There are also many big restaurants like Chang 'an jiaozi Tower, Jinling Restaurant, Sanhelou Restaurant and Laozhengxing Restaurant, and there is also the "Great World Food Street" of Xiao Shaoxing Group in Yunnan Middle Road. Xiaojingling salted duck, "Nanxiang" steamed buns and "Old Sichuan" hot pot are quite famous in Yunnan Road. The restaurants in Yunnan Road are mainly Chinese food, mostly Shanghai food, Sichuan food, and occasionally some Shandong food. Due to the different grades of restaurants in Yunnan Road, the prices are uneven. Fame determines the level of consumption to some extent in this street.

huanghe road: If you want to go to huanghe road Food Street, you have to turn on Nanjing Road. There are nearly 111 restaurants, large and small, which flourished in the mid-1991s. Most of them are Shanghai cuisine and seafood restaurants, and occasionally you can see words like boiled fish and kebabs. There is also a griddle base in huanghe road, which specializes in Guizhou cuisine. Since this spring, Guizhou cuisine has been quite popular in Shanghai, and the business of this restaurant is naturally good. Huanghe road mostly drinks at home, with per capita consumption ranging from 41 to 61 yuan. These home-cooked dishes, including Sichuan cuisine, Hunan cuisine and Guizhou cuisine, have been improved in taste and are very popular with local people in Shanghai. Like the six-story Laitianhua Restaurant, when business is good, it can also be full, not to mention those restaurants located on the first floor. In huanghe road, the roads are crowded and the shops are narrow. In order to maximize the use of space, many stores will divide restaurants with only one floor into two floors. Looking out of the window, the upper floor seems to float in the air. This is probably a major feature of Shanghai's alley cuisine.

western fashion hongji plaza: located near Xujiahui, surrounded by many high-end office buildings, it has formed a food and beverage street with tea restaurants, various noodle restaurants, cafes, barbecues, pizzas and many other leisure foods. The consumers here are mainly foreigners with blond hair and blue eyes, or white-collar workers in office buildings. The overall style is mainly leisure, and they play with real petty bourgeoisie. There are all kinds of curry noodles in Xinmatai, barbecue in Brazil, macaroni in Italy, sashimi in Japan and mutton in Xinjiang. Therefore, in terms of price, it is also quite expensive, and it costs a little to play fashion.
